BBP Stepped Housing

Two stepped buildings near Brooklyn Bridge Park's Atlantic Avenue entrance combine market-rate and affordable housing with active public spaces. The design preserves harbor views through cascading terraces while anchoring the ground level with community amenities and a seasonal plaza that transitions from winter ice skating to summer farmers markets.

  • Client: Brooklyn Bridge Park Development Corporation
  • Location: Brooklyn, NY
  • Program: Housing, Affordable Housing, Public Facilities
  • Size: 400,000 sf
  • Structural Engineering: Gace
  • Systems Engineering: WSP
  • Proposed: June 15th, 2014
  • Proposal developed with: SBN and WXY

The ground floor is heavily programmed with public amenities that serve the community and park goers. Tenant amenities are pulled above the ground level and spread vertically through the buildings.
